☕ Elevate your mornings with espresso perfection at home!
The AGARO Imperial Espresso Coffee Maker delivers professional-grade espresso with 15 bars of pressure and 1100W power. Featuring dual thermostats and an analogue dial, it offers precise control over water and milk temperatures for rich coffee and creamy froth. Its stainless steel body combines durability with style, while the included tamper, portafilter, and 1.5L water tank make it a complete home barista solution.

Reliable Home Espresso Machine Experience
I've been using the Agaro Imperial Espresso Coffee Machine for a few days now, and it’s been a great addition to my home setup. It's incredibly easy to use, even for someone who’s still experimenting with cappuccinos and lattes like me. The controls are intuitive, and I’ve consistently been able to brew delicious coffee with minimal effort.In terms of value for money, this machine really shines for home users. It delivers quality espresso drinks without the hefty price tag of high-end machines, making it a smart investment for coffee lovers who want café-style beverages at home.The build quality feels solid, and everything from the portafilter to the steam wand is thoughtfully designed. A minor inconvenience is that the frother handle is a bit short, which meant I had to buy a smaller milk pitcher. Not a dealbreaker, but something to keep in mind.One useful tip for first-time users: there was a slight plastic taste in the first couple of brews. This was easily resolved by thoroughly washing the water tank with soap and running a full tank of water through the machine before making the first cup.A special shout-out to Ms. Mampi Roy, who provided an excellent virtual demonstration. She was clear, thorough, and addressed every practical detail—from setup and precautions to cleaning and troubleshooting—which really helped me get started with confidence.All in all, this is a reliable, user-friendly coffee machine that delivers great results and is well worth the price for home use. With a slightly longer frother wand, it would be a full 5 stars!
N**L
Works great...requires some mastery over time
It's a simple , easy to use machine. It doesn't eat up much space on the counter and is quite compact. It looks premium and has a solid build.You can look up videos on Youtube for its functioning.Performance wise i think it's great.The manual button is particularly useful if you know for how much time you want to extract the coffee.The portafilter in this is 51mm so whatever tools you buy should be of that calibre. I was experiencing some issues with the coffee puck on my first few uses. If you feel that the coffee flow isn't too good then try using a coarser grind for the beans.I use the agaro electric coffee grinder and I usually set the grind at 2 or 3 mark ..that works best for an expresso.Overall the product is good and quite cheap too . It's a good but for coffee nerds who are starting out new on this venture 😌Edit:I've been using it for a month now..here are some more points i though would be worth mentioning. The steam nozzle is a bit short. I think it would be better had it been longer in length.Another thing lacking in the machine is the steam control knob..there is no way of controlling the flow of the steam jet...it's just of and on ...no way of controlling the flow or the the speed of the steam jet..a control knob would have been good ..2nd EditIt's been 2 months now since I've used it. It does getting some time to master the espresso shot you'll be taking out. What I do is that i grind the coffee beans at number 5 setting on the agaro coffee grinder (electric )..and to prepare the coffee puck i tamp it down as hard a possible.. these combination of settings prepares the ideal coffee puck pre espresso extraction..The second tip i follow is to measure the coffee beans and take out the espresso shot at twice the amount . For example if I'm taking 15 grams of coffee then i aim at a final espresso volume of 30 grams ..i use the manual button for this always ..i use a bottomless portafilter (photo included) for this and not the traditional basket provided with this particular coffee machine ..I also use a weighing scale..it's a bit complex but when you maser it it's damn rewarding ! 😅😅👍👍👍💪💪
